ZINGIBERACEAE - WIKIPEDIA
Zingiberaceae or the ginger family is a family of flowering plants made up of about 50 genera with a total of about 1600 known species of aromatic perennial herbs with creeping horizontal or tuberous rhizomes distributed throughout tropical Africa, Asia, and the Americas. Many of the family's species are important ornamental, spice, or medicinal plants. Ornamental genera include the shell gingers (Alpinia), …

CURCUMA ALISMATIFOLIA SIAM 'SOLAR' - GINGERWOOD NURSERY - SIAM …
Web Curcuma alismatifolia ‘Solar’ from the Siam series is a much sought after cultivar that finally started becoming available last year. Within pure Curcuma alimatifolia there are no reds or yellows. Yellow as a bract color is exceptionally rare within all Curcuma species. ‘Solar’ is the closest yet to yellow with its creamy coloring.

GINGER CURCUMA SIAM SPARKLING - TREE FARM & NURSERY
Web Ginger Curcuma alismatifolia ‘Siam Sparkling’ / Siam Tulip Origins: – Another member of the Zingiberaceae family plant that is native to its tropical Loas, Thailand and Cambodia. Curcuma’s are hardy perennial plants that grow from underground rhizomes and are surprisingly easy to grow!
